Paralelo

Jenkins

Jenkins
  1. ¿Las etapas de Jenkins funcionan en paralelo??
  2. Las etapas pueden funcionar en paralelo?
  3. ¿Qué sección en tuberías se utiliza para ejecutar etapas en paralelo??
  4. ¿Puede Jenkins ejecutar Jobs en paralelo??
  5. ¿Podemos tener múltiples pasos en el escenario en Jenkins Pipeline??
  6. ¿El procesamiento de la tubería utiliza el procesamiento paralelo??
  7. ¿Es mejor ejecutar en serie o en paralelo??
  8. ¿Pueden dos procesos funcionar en paralelo pero pueden no ser concurrentes??
  9. ¿Pueden dos procesos ejecutarse tanto simultáneamente como en paralelo??
  10. ¿Cómo configuro la ejecución paralela en Jenkins??
  11. ¿Cómo ejecuto múltiples trabajos en paralelo en Jenkins??
  12. ¿Qué tipo de paralelismo es el canalización??
  13. ¿Cómo ejecuto dos trabajos secuencialmente en Jenkins??
  14. ¿Podemos ejecutar la tubería en paralelo??
  15. ¿Cuántos trabajos se pueden ejecutar en paralelo dentro del sistema??
  16. ¿Cómo ejecuto múltiples trabajos en paralelo en Jenkins??
  17. Jenkins no es capaz de manejar construcciones paralelas y distribuidas?
  18. ¿Cuáles son las 2 formas de integración continua en Jenkins??
  19. ¿Por qué es mejor ejecutar múltiples trabajos en paralelo versus secuencialmente?
  20. ¿Cómo ejecuto dos trabajos secuencialmente en Jenkins??
  21. ¿Cuántos trabajos se pueden ejecutar en paralelo dentro del sistema??
  22. Por qué no debemos usar la transmisión paralela?
  23. ¿Cuáles son los 3 tipos de tuberías en Jenkins??
  24. Por qué Jenkins está desactualizado?

¿Las etapas de Jenkins funcionan en paralelo??

Use etapas anidadas y paralelas en las tuberías de Jenkins con guiones para acelerar la ejecución de su tubería. Las solicitudes de cambio se crean para etapas anidadas y paralelas y no solo para la etapa principal.

Las etapas pueden funcionar en paralelo?

Las etapas se ejecutan con un gatillo o al comenzar manualmente. Con un disparador posterior al lanzamiento, comenzará una etapa tan pronto como comience el lanzamiento, en paralelo con otras etapas que tienen el disparo después del lanzamiento.

¿Qué sección en tuberías se utiliza para ejecutar etapas en paralelo??

Al usar "tuberías declarativas", los bloques paralelos se pueden anidar dentro de los bloques de etapa (ver etapas paralelas con la tubería declarativa 1.2).

¿Puede Jenkins ejecutar Jobs en paralelo??

Ejecución de trabajo paralelo en Jenkins

En Jenkins, hay varias formas de implementar la ejecución del trabajo paralelo. Uno de los enfoques comunes es el modelo de construcción matriz-hijo. En este modelo: un trabajo padre (aguas arriba) está desencadenando trabajos de niños (aguas abajo).

¿Podemos tener múltiples pasos en el escenario en Jenkins Pipeline??

Jenkins Pipeline le permite componer múltiples pasos de una manera fácil que puede ayudarlo a modelar cualquier tipo de proceso de automatización. Piense en un "paso" como un solo comando que realiza una sola acción. Cuando un paso tiene éxito, se mueve al siguiente paso. Cuando un paso no se ejecuta correctamente, la tubería fallará.

¿El procesamiento de la tubería utiliza el procesamiento paralelo??

El canalización [1] es una estrategia de procesamiento paralelo en la que una operación o un cálculo se divide en etapas disjuntas. Las testajes deben ejecutarse en un orden particular (podría ser un orden parcial) para que la operación o el cálculo se complete con éxito.

¿Es mejor ejecutar en serie o en paralelo??

Puede aprovechar el clúster aún mejor al ejecutar sus trabajos en paralelo que en serie. De esta manera, podría ejecutar muchas más tareas a la vez (simultáneamente) y lograr un resultado más rápido.

¿Pueden dos procesos funcionar en paralelo pero pueden no ser concurrentes??

Una aplicación puede ser paralela pero no concurrente, lo que significa que procesa múltiples subcartas de una sola tarea al mismo tiempo. Una aplicación no puede ser paralela ni concurrente, lo que significa que procesa una tarea a la vez, secuencialmente, y la tarea nunca se divide en subtareas.

¿Pueden dos procesos ejecutarse tanto simultáneamente como en paralelo??

Una aplicación puede ser paralela y concurrente, lo que significa que procesa múltiples tareas simultáneamente en CPU de múltiples núcleos al mismo tiempo.

¿Cómo configuro la ejecución paralela en Jenkins??

Este complemento agrega una herramienta que le permite ejecutar fácilmente pruebas en paralelo. Esto se logra haciendo que Jenkins mire el tiempo de ejecución de la prueba de la última ejecución, divida las pruebas en múltiples unidades de aproximadamente igual tamaño y luego las ejecute en paralelo.

¿Cómo ejecuto múltiples trabajos en paralelo en Jenkins??

Primero debe crear una nueva tubería de Jenkins con cualquier nombre "Jobs paralelos" con el siguiente código de tubería (Groovy). En el siguiente código he definido el grupo1 con def. Group1 tiene Job01, Job02, Job03. Estoy ejecutando el comando echo solo para imprimir el título y obtener la fecha de ejecución usando el comando shell.

¿Qué tipo de paralelismo es el canalización??

Por qué funciona el canalización: paralelismo a nivel de instrucción. Las tuberías funcionan porque muchas instrucciones que se ejecutan secuencialmente están haciendo tareas independientes que se pueden hacer en paralelo. Este tipo de paralelismo se llama paralelismo a nivel de instrucción (ILP).

¿Cómo ejecuto dos trabajos secuencialmente en Jenkins??

Muchas 'fases' se pueden configurar como parte del proyecto MultiJob y cada fase "contiene" uno o más "otros" trabajos de Jenkins. Cuando se ejecuta el proyecto multijob, las fases se ejecutarán secuencialmente. Por lo tanto, para ejecutar n trabajos secuencialmente, agregue n fases a su proyecto multijob y luego agregue un trabajo a cada fase.

¿Podemos ejecutar la tubería en paralelo??

En las tuberías de Azure, puede ejecutar trabajos paralelos en infraestructura alojada en Microsoft o su propia infraestructura (autohostada). Cada trabajo paralelo le permite ejecutar un solo trabajo a la vez en su organización.

¿Cuántos trabajos se pueden ejecutar en paralelo dentro del sistema??

Depende totalmente del trabajo que esté ejecutando. Digamos, por ejemplo, si es un trabajo complejo que necesita 6 GB de RAM mínimo, entonces puede ejecutar 6 trabajos en paralelo.

¿Cómo ejecuto múltiples trabajos en paralelo en Jenkins??

Primero debe crear una nueva tubería de Jenkins con cualquier nombre "Jobs paralelos" con el siguiente código de tubería (Groovy). En el siguiente código he definido el grupo1 con def. Group1 tiene Job01, Job02, Job03. Estoy ejecutando el comando echo solo para imprimir el título y obtener la fecha de ejecución usando el comando shell.

Jenkins no es capaz de manejar construcciones paralelas y distribuidas?

Jenkins es capaz de manejar compilaciones paralelas y distribuidas. En esta pantalla, puede configurar cuántas compilaciones desea. Jenkins se ejecuta simultáneamente y, si está utilizando compilaciones distribuidas, configure nodos de compilación. Un nodo de compilación es otra máquina que Jenkins puede usar para ejecutar sus compilaciones.

¿Cuáles son las 2 formas de integración continua en Jenkins??

¿Qué es Jenkins?? Jenkins es una implementación de código abierto de un servidor de integración continuo escrito en Java. Funciona con múltiples lenguajes de programación y puede ejecutarse en varias plataformas (Windows, Linux y MacOS). Se usa ampliamente como CI (integración continua) & Herramienta CD (entrega continua).

¿Por qué es mejor ejecutar múltiples trabajos en paralelo versus secuencialmente?

Puede aprovechar el clúster aún mejor al ejecutar sus trabajos en paralelo que en serie. De esta manera, podría ejecutar muchas más tareas a la vez (simultáneamente) y lograr un resultado más rápido. La imagen de arriba representa cómo una tarea es ejecutada en serie por un solo procesador.

¿Cómo ejecuto dos trabajos secuencialmente en Jenkins??

Seleccionar compilación->Agregar paso de compilación->Disparar/llamar se basa en otros proyectos. Ingrese el nombre de trabajo secuencial. Verifique el bloque 'hasta que los proyectos activados terminen sus construcciones' casilla de verificación (esto solo aparece cuando tiene instalado el complemento de activación parametrizado)

¿Cuántos trabajos se pueden ejecutar en paralelo dentro del sistema??

Depende totalmente del trabajo que esté ejecutando. Digamos, por ejemplo, si es un trabajo complejo que necesita 6 GB de RAM mínimo, entonces puede ejecutar 6 trabajos en paralelo.

Por qué no debemos usar la transmisión paralela?

Del mismo modo, no use paralelo si se ordena la corriente y tiene muchos más elementos de los que desea procesar, e.gramo. Esto puede durar mucho más tiempo porque los hilos paralelos pueden funcionar en muchos rangos numéricos en lugar del crucial de 0-100, lo que hace que esto tome mucho tiempo.

¿Cuáles son los 3 tipos de tuberías en Jenkins??

Diferentes tipos de tuberías de Jenkins CI/CD. Tubería. Oleoducto. El concepto de etapas en la tubería de Jenkins.

Por qué Jenkins está desactualizado?

Muchos complementos de Jenkins no se mantienen y se han vuelto redundantes. Esto está causando problemas de compatibilidad con el nuevo estilo de tubería declarativo. A medida que Jenkins está envejeciendo, su diseño e interfaz de usuario tampoco están actualizados. La interfaz de usuario de Jenkins tampoco es muy amigable.

Mostrar contenedores Docker bien formateados
¿Cómo muestro un contenedor Docker en ejecución??¿Qué comando se usa para verificar la ejecución de contenedores Docker?Cómo verificar el estado de e...
Cómo crear, pero no sobrescribir, un archivo y administrar sus permisos con Ansible?
¿La copia ansible se sobrescribe??¿Cómo creo un archivo vacío en Ansible??¿Cómo creo un archivo con contenido en Ansible??¿Qué es item en Ansible?¿Co...
¿Cuáles son algunas formas seguras de ejecutar Chown y Chmod en un script de implementación de GitLab??
¿Cuál es el uso de chown y chmod en Linux cuándo es necesario cambiar los permisos de un archivo??¿Qué es la seguridad de la implementación??¿Cómo le...